ive heard that the heads on a ca18de is the same as the head on a ca18det if this is true is it the same for the sr20de and its turbo counterpart. thanks

heads for sr20de and sr20det are different. they have the same combustion chamber but different cams(sometimes), valves, valve guides, valve seals, etc. the rwd and fwd heads also have a few differences. then there are the highports/lowports, normal/vtc/vvl, and other differences. what specifically are you looking for?

heh, that would make life much easier but im afraid it wont work. i wish it would but we are stuck with the fwd/rwd and na/turbo specific motors. some parts are interchangable but not blocks and heads(without some serious mods).
